Valentine's Day Cupcakes by Ann Voskamp, A Holy Experience This isn’t what you think. It’s not about mushy, pie-in-the-sky, singing-in-the-rain romance. (Although there is a little rain as you’ll soon see. And there’s a big surprise for you!)

Nope, this is about a different kind of love, a different kind of story…yours.

But let’s start with the rain first.

One day as I gathered books and stepped into the hall I saw a familiar face wearing a smile and holding an umbrella. My future husband came to walk me through the rain. And my love story came to life.

Years later, during a difficult storm in my life God used that memory to show me that He, too, wanted to walk me through the rain. And my love story came to life.

Almost half a decade of hurt and hope went by. I shared what God had done with other women. It helped heal their hearts too. And my love story came to life.

We’re made for love. And it comes whenever the divine shows up in the ordinary, whether that’s through family, friends, a cause that captures our hearts, or totally unexpected moments.

Lean in and I’ll whisper a secret…

It’s not about happily-ever-after.

It’s about eternity.

God is the Author and He is love. (Hebrews 12:2, 1 John 4:16)

That means we’re all living a love story.

And not just on Valentine’s Day but forever.

Now that’s worth celebrating!
